This review is from: Harvey Couch: An entrepreneur brings electricity to Arkansas (Hardcover)
Harvey Couch is the inspirational story of the founder of several southern utilities. It is currently in every Arkansas school and public library.Couch has only two years of formal education, but with drive and ambition built an empire that included electric utilities, railroads, and a trucking company. Perhaps my favorite story is when Harvey Couch and his brother Pete "borrowed" a train to distribute utility poles for their first enterprise - a telephone company. In a rather cynical age, the Harvey Couch story is a throwback to an earlier age. In school, Harvey Couch's teacher told him, "Men like you have built empires." Couch believed him and that's why there's a book about him in every Arkansas library. |
